One cup of Tsp maple syrup is around 240 grams and contains approximately 840 calories, 0 grams of protein, 0 grams of fat, and 212.0 grams of carbohydrates.
Tsp Maple Syrup is a pure, natural sweetener harvested from the sap of sugar maple trees in North America. With its rich, amber hue and distinct flavor, this versatile syrup is perfect for drizzling over pancakes, baking, or enhancing savory dishes. Packed with antioxidants and essential minerals like manganese and zinc, Tsp Maple Syrup offers a healthier alternative to refined sugars.
